A late-60s British band that didn't get very far, but had successful alumni: Gary Wright, who went on to have solo hits, e.g., the massed Moog overdubs of "Dreamweaver"; Mick Jones (no, not that one), who went on to form Foreigner and collaborate with Billy Joel; Luther Grosvenor (a.k.a. Ariel Bender), who joined Mott the Hoople. One of their bigger hits was the LP Ceremony (1969), which featured musique-concrète overdubs by the pop-o-phobic Pierre Henry.
